Secondary–secondary diamine catalysts for the enantioselective Michael addition of cyclic ketones to nitroalkenes

摘要

Secondary–secondary diamines derived from S-proline are efficient catalysts for the ketone– nitroalkene Michael addition reaction. The stereoselectivity of the Michael addition is dependant on the pKa of the N-substituted aminomethyl pendant in these diamines. N′- Aryl aminomethyl pyrrolidines provide γ-nitroketones with moderate to good enantiomeric excess (65–92%). Removal of the hydrogen-bond donor group by N-methylation results in ...
